From ee3e7604095258ec63af3fc837e51065a953a2f7 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Alexandre Belloni Date: Wed, 8 Jun 2016 01:31:19 +0200 Subject: ARM: dts: at91: ma5d4: properly define crystals frequencies The Denx MA5D4 dts doesn't properly define the slow_xtal and main_xtal frequencies, the PMC then has to fallback to using the RC oscillators whose precision is not really good. As both crystals are populated, define their frequencies, see p17 of http://www.denx-cs.de/sites/all/files/MA5D4.HWM_.002.pdf Also, remove the obsolete main_clock definition.
